Get hired as a professional fisher
The most obvious way to make money fishing is by hiring on as a professional fisher. This includes working for a boat or commercial fisher. You can find these types of positions by searching for them online and on job board sites like Indeed. These jobs are typically open to those who have the credentials and experience necessary, so check the requirements before applying.
The average yearly pay for a professional fisher is $40,000 with some positions earning upwards of $80,000 per year . If you’re just starting out as a fisher you can expect lower wages. Your wages should increase depending on your experience level and expertise.
How to get started: check out job boards in your area.

Participate or start your own fishing guide tours
There are plenty of people who will pay good money to learn how to fish. Businesses like fishing guide tours provide the opportunity for people to learn to fish without the knowledge or equipment required.
If you already own your own boat or have access to one, you can get started by offering your own one-on-one guided fishing tours. This requires little money and time because you will be using your personal boat, gear and skills while offering personalized lessons tailored to each customer’s needs.
You can also offer group tours or fishing lessons in classrooms with your own gear or rented equipment. This typically requires more effort and time compared to one-on-one tours so be ready for long days on the water.
If you don’t have access to a boat then consider joining an established fishing tour company to get your feet wet.
How to get started: start your own fishing tour business by setting up a Facebook page advertising your services. You can also post about your services in local group boards.

How much money can you actually make with a fishing related business?
The amount of money you can make can vary greatly depending on what type of business you run. The businesses listed above are the ones that typically have the best chance for success however there are other options out there that may be more appealing to certain individuals.
For example, hiring on as a fisherman for the company may be the best chance for a steady income but it’ll be on the lower end of what’s possible. This could be in the $40,000 per year mark. This is similar for other for hire positions like working trade expos, etc.
However, if you’re able to start your own business like a blog, boating guide, or food truck then the ceiling can be a lot higher depending on how well you set up and run your business.

How profitable is the fishing industry?
The fishing industry as a whole supported 1.2 million jobs in 2016 and generated over $140 billion dollars. This includes harvesters, processors, dealers, wholesalers, and retailers. There’s money to be made in fishing no matter where you’re at in the chain of sales.
New to fishing?
If you’re new to fishing you’ll want to make sure you get a fishing license. This way you’re able to fish legally and protect yourself from a fine. There are a few different options depending on your local area that range from a one-day license all the way up to an annual fishing one.
You’ll also want to make sure you have the right gear. While some people opt to go on a fishing trip with friends and use their gear, if this is your first time you’ll want to purchase your own.
